To keep your batteries in the best condition, leave the handset off the base for a few hours at a time. Running the batteries right down at least once a week will help them last as long as possible. The charge capacity of rechargeable batteries will reduce with time as they wear out, giving the handset less talk / standby time.

Phonebook You can store up to 50 names and numbers in the phonebook. Names can be up to 12 characters long and numbers up to 24 digits. Store a name and number If the C1CB+ is connected to a switchboard, you may need to enter a pause in a stored number.

Call block Your phone can block calls by call types or by numbers. Up to 10 numbers can be blocked. For this feature to work, you must subscribe to Caller ID Service from your network operator. A subscription fee may be payable. You can access the call block menu by pressing and holding in standby mode or through the handset menu.

Base settings ECO mode Your C1CB+ offers ECO mode function which reduces the transmitted power and energy consumption when switched on. To switch Eco mode on: Press , scroll ADVANCED SET. 2. Press , scroll ECO MODE and press or OFF. 3.
Recall mode This setting is useful to access certain network and PABX/switchboard services. The default recall time is suitable for your country and network operator. It is unlikely that you should need to change this setting unless advised to do so. Press , scroll ADVANCED...

Technical Information How many telephones can I have? All items of telephone equipment have a Ringer Equivalence Number (REN), which is used to calculate the number of items which may be connected to any one telephone line. Your C1CB+ has a REN of 1. A total REN of 4 is allowed. If the total REN of 4 is exceeded, the telephones may not ring.
